OpenAI Launches ChatGPT Desktop App Preview for Linux

OpenAI has released a preview version of the ChatGPT desktop app for Linux, supporting major distributions including Ubuntu, Debian, and Fedora. This release brings native ChatGPT, ChatGPT Work, and Codex integration directly to Linux-based developers and technical users, streamlining their coding and browser workflows. The application is available for both x64 and ARM64 architectures and can be installed using `.deb` or `.rpm` packages.

## BACKGROUND

Linux distributions manage software installation using package formats like `.deb` (for Debian and Ubuntu) and `.rpm` (for Fedora and Red Hat). Additionally, OpenAI Codex is an AI-driven coding agent designed to automate software engineering tasks such as writing code and completing pull requests.
